71911 CD/HCP4AQBCA Bearing Product Overview & Core Advantages

The 71911 CD/HCP4AQBCA is a high-precision quadruplex angular contact ball bearing designed for demanding applications requiring exceptional rigidity and accuracy. This matched set of four bearings in a back-to-back (QBC) arrangement provides superior stability under combined loads, effectively handling radial and axial forces simultaneously. Manufactured to P4A tolerance class with a 15° contact angle and ceramic balls, it delivers outstanding high-speed performance and operational precision, making it ideal for high-reliability, high-rigidity systems.

71911 CD/HCP4AQBCA Bearing Model Code Explained, Specifications & Naming Convention

Code Segment Technical Meaning
71911 Basic bearing series and size designation
CD 15° contact angle design
HC Hybrid ceramic construction (steel rings with ceramic balls)
P4A High precision tolerance class (superior to ABEC 7)
QBC Quadruplex back-to-back matched arrangement

71911 CD/HCP4AQBCA Bearing Structural Features & Performance Benefits

Exceptional Rigidity: The quadruplex back-to-back configuration creates an extremely rigid bearing system that minimizes deflection under heavy combined loads, ensuring precise shaft positioning and system stability.

Superior High-Speed Capability: Featuring ceramic balls and a phenolic cage, this bearing achieves reduced centrifugal forces and lower operating temperatures, enabling limiting speeds up to 39,000 rpm while maintaining precision.

Enhanced Load Capacity: With a radial dynamic load rating of 11,408 lbf and static load rating of 13,162 lbf, this bearing sustains significant radial and axial loads simultaneously, supported by the optimized 15° contact angle.

Precision Engineering: Manufactured to P4A tolerance class with tight dimensional controls (bore and OD tolerance: -0.004mm to 0), this bearing ensures minimal runout and vibration for high-precision applications.
